Scholarships from granting agencies
The research granting agencies of the governments of Canada and Québec offer several merit scholarship programs to current and future graduate students.
These scholarships recognize academic achievement, encourage academic research, and provide opportunities to gain professional and research experience.
Upcoming competitions
Granting agencies’ competitions generally take place from August through December each year.

Eligibility of international students
International students pursuing a master’s degree may only apply for scholarships from the Fonds de recherche du Québec (FRQ). Doctoral students, on the other hand, are eligible to apply for scholarships from all granting agencies.
Selection process
In collaboration with the Faculty of Graduate and Postdoctoral Studies (FESP), the Student Awards and Financial Aid Office (BBAF) is responsible for overseeing the internal selection process for these competitions. The recommended applications are submitted to the granting agencies for the final stage of the selection process.
